+/// \brief Represents a C++0x pack expansion that produces a sequence of
+/// expressions.
+///
+/// A pack expansion expression contains a pattern (which itself is an
+/// expression) followed by an ellipsis. For example:
+///
+/// \code
+/// template<typename F, typename ...Types>
+/// void forward(F f, Types &&...args) {
+/// f(static_cast<Types&&>(args)...);
+/// }
+/// \endcode
+///
+/// Here, the argument to the function object \c f is a pack expansion whose
+/// pattern is \c static_cast<Types&&>(args). When the \c forward function
+/// template is instantiated, the pack expansion will instantiate to zero or
+/// or more function arguments to the function object \c f.
+class PackExpansionExpr : public Expr {
+ SourceLocation EllipsisLoc;
+ Stmt *Pattern;
+
+ friend class ASTStmtReader;
+
+public:
+ PackExpansionExpr(QualType T, Expr *Pattern, SourceLocation EllipsisLoc)
+ : Expr(PackExpansionExprClass, T, Pattern->getValueKind(),
+ Pattern->getObjectKind(), /*TypeDependent=*/true,
+ /*ValueDependent=*/true, /*ContainsUnexpandedParameterPack=*/false),
+ EllipsisLoc(EllipsisLoc),
+ Pattern(Pattern) { }
+
+ PackExpansionExpr(EmptyShell Empty) : Expr(PackExpansionExprClass, Empty) { }
+
+ /// \brief Retrieve the pattern of the pack expansion.
+ Expr *getPattern() { return reinterpret_cast<Expr *>(Pattern); }
+
+ /// \brief Retrieve the pattern of the pack expansion.
+ const Expr *getPattern() const { return reinterpret_cast<Expr *>(Pattern); }
+
+ /// \brief Retrieve the location of the ellipsis that describes this pack
+ /// expansion.
+ SourceLocation getEllipsisLoc() const { return EllipsisLoc; }
+
+ virtual SourceRange getSourceRange() const;
+
+ static bool classof(const Stmt *T) {
+ return T->getStmtClass() == PackExpansionExprClass;
+ }
+ static bool classof(const PackExpansionExpr *) { return true; }
+
+ // Iterators
+ virtual child_iterator child_begin();
+ virtual child_iterator child_end();
+};
